Transaction 420afee7159f0c6fc03802419a261ff07a705e7c41850a728ab476995d3df204

4 Input
2 Outputs
  • 420afee7159f0c6fc03802419a261ff07a705e7c41850a728ab476995d3df204:0
  • value  27420000
    address  1287Eze7Tu4G4fs7B3uzYTTDpDzoqfqxmk
  • 420afee7159f0c6fc03802419a261ff07a705e7c41850a728ab476995d3df204:1
  • value  10857626
    address  bc1qz9wr3ehqerkn4gp54a7h645uzgqatvut0mvzk3